We started the tomato, tomatillo, and pepper seeds. It is quite the anticipation builder to have little pots of dirt that are full of promise for awesome heirloom tomatoes! Fingers are crossed.
The romas, gold medal tomatoes and tomatillos were the first to pop up. Dan is hoping the peppers follow soon! It has been pretty chilly so we are using the heating pad to add a little bottom heat which is suppose to help get the seeds started.
